Wichita, Kansas – New Year’s Day is getting off to a calm and manageable start across south central Kansas, with mild temperatures and limited weather concerns after some early morning fog. Conditions improve steadily through the day, making travel and outdoor plans easier than what’s typical for early January.
According to the National Weather Service in Wichita, patchy fog developed early this morning across parts of central and southeast Kansas, mainly affecting rural roads and low-lying areas around daybreak. Visibility improves by late morning as clouds thin and sunshine becomes more dominant. Afternoon temperatures are expected to climb into the upper 40s and 50s, well above seasonal averages.
Wichita, Hutchinson, Newton, and surrounding communities will see highs near the mid to upper 50s this afternoon. Farther southeast toward Winfield and Coffeyville, temperatures may briefly approach the upper 50s under partly sunny skies. Winds remain light, limiting additional travel issues once fog clears.
The mild pattern continues into the weekend with mostly dry conditions statewide. A weak system may bring a spotty shower to parts of southeast Kansas on Friday, but widespread rain is not expected. Overnight lows dip into the upper 20s and 30s, keeping any moisture limited.
Drivers heading out early this morning should remain cautious in fog-prone areas, especially along highways and county roads. Allow extra distance between vehicles and use low-beam headlights where visibility drops.
Looking ahead, temperatures trend warmer into the weekend and early next week, with increasing sunshine and highs pushing into the 60s by Sunday and Monday. No winter weather headlines are posted at this time, and conditions remain quiet across the region.
